Pharmacy Automation Systems Market, Segmentation by Product
The Product segmentation reflects comprehensive automation technologies supporting medication safety, dispensing precision and workflow optimization. Increasing prescription volumes, error-reduction mandates and labor shortages propel investment in automated pharmacy systems.
Medication Dispensing CabinetsAutomated dispensing cabinets provide secure, trackable medication access at the point of care. Their integration with EHRs enhances accuracy and reduces dispensing errors in hospital and clinical settings.
Packaging & Labelling MachinesThese machines support high-throughput packaging, barcoding and labeling essential for dose accuracy and compliance. Demand is driven by the need for unit-dose distribution and workflow standardization.
IV PharmacyIV pharmacy systems automate sterile compounding, dose preparation and admixture verification. Hospitals increasingly adopt these systems to improve safety and alignment with sterile-compounding regulations.
Robotic Dispensing MachinesRobotic dispensing offers precision-driven medication selection and reduces human handling errors. High adoption occurs in retail and mail-order pharmacies for continuous, high-volume operations.
Carousel StorageCarousel systems enable automated, space-efficient storage with real-time retrieval control. Their integration improves picking accuracy and reduces medication search time.
Tablet SplittersAutomated tablet splitters ensure uniform, accurate dose division, supporting personalized dosing, senior care and chronic-disease therapy adjustments.
Pharmacy Automation Systems Market, Segmentation by Application
The Application segmentation showcases how automation enhances dispensing safety, operational efficiency and medication accountability across pharmacy workflows. Rising regulatory scrutiny and error-prevention initiatives strengthen deployment across care settings.
Drug Dispensing & PackagingAutomation improves speed, accuracy and consistency in medication dispensing and packaging. Systems mitigate human error and support high-volume workflows in retail and institutional pharmacies.
Drug StorageAutomated storage systems ensure secure, temperature-controlled and traceable medication management. Real-time tracking helps reduce waste and improve compliance.
Inventory ManagementInventory platforms automate stock monitoring, expiration tracking and reorder alerts. This reduces shortages, mitigates waste and optimizes operational costs.
Pharmacy Automation Systems Market, Segmentation by End User
The End User segmentation reflects adoption across diverse pharmacy environments focused on workflow efficiency, safety improvements and medication-accuracy mandates. Increasing patient loads and staffing challenges accelerate automation uptake.
Hospital PharmaciesHospitals lead adoption for controlled dispensing, sterile compounding and integrated medication management. Automation supports high-acuity care and regulatory compliance.
Clinic PharmaciesClinic pharmacies invest in automation to improve medication turnaround time, secure storage and prescribing accuracy for outpatient and specialty care.
Retail PharmaciesRetail chains deploy automation for high-volume dispensing, inventory control and improved customer service. Robotics enhance speed and reduce labor burden.
Mail Order PharmaciesMail order facilities use advanced automation for continuous, large-scale filling and packaging. Robotics and automated storage are essential for meeting rising subscription-based medication demand.

Limited adoption in smaller or rural pharmacies - One of the main challenges for the pharmacy automation systems market is the limited adoption among smaller and rural pharmacies. Financial limitations often prevent these providers from investing in expensive automation hardware and software. Even though long-term operational benefits are clear, the initial cost of implementation remains a barrier for many.
In many rural settings, lack of digital infrastructure further compounds the issue. Manual operations are still prevalent, and transitioning to automated systems requires substantial investments in IT, staff training, and regular maintenance. This results in a slower digital transformation for these underserved regions.
Low prescription volumes also reduce the financial justification for automation in smaller pharmacies. With slower return on investment, these facilities continue relying on manual systems, which hinders operational efficiency and limits competitiveness. To bridge this gap, targeted policy support, shared infrastructure models, or cost-effective solutions must be introduced. Until such strategies are implemented, automation adoption will remain uneven across the pharmacy landscape.
